软考,即计算机技术与软件专业技术资格(水平)考试,是我国在计算机软件领域设立的一项重要考试。它旨在评估参与者在计算机软件技术和应用方面的专业能力和水平。对于许多从事或希望从事IT行业的人来说,软考不仅是他们展示技能的一种方式,也是他们职业发展的重要跳板。那么,在这个广泛的考试体系中,软考是否涉及数据库相关的内容呢?
首先,我们需要明确的是,软考作为一个涵盖了多个层次和多个专业的考试体系,其内容是
原创
2024-03-15 15:17:39
11阅读
# Java学习不涉及数据库的实现方法
对于刚入行的开发者来说,刚开始学习Java,可能会对数据库有些迷茫。实际上,Java是可以不涉及数据库的,特别是在学习基础知识和编程逻辑的时候。本文将以一个简单的流程,带你一步一步地实现Java学习不涉及数据库的案例。
## 整体流程
我们可以将实现过程拆分为以下几个步骤:
```markdown
| 步骤 | 说明
# Java中涉及数据库需要使用try的原因和实现方法
在Java中,当涉及到与数据库进行交互的操作时,通常需要使用try块来处理异常。这是因为数据库操作可能会引发各种异常,例如连接异常、查询异常等,为了保证程序的健壮性和稳定性,我们需要使用try块进行异常处理。本篇文章将详细介绍在Java中涉及数据库操作需要使用try的原因和实现方法。
## 1. 整体流程
在介绍详细的实现方法之前,我们
原创
2023-08-25 12:23:19
210阅读
第一阶段:JAVASE核心技术JAVA的基础,也是JAVA的魂和紧紧相连的数据库。最重要的JAVASE,就是JAVA的基础部分。举个例子:任何一个试卷80%都是基础,没有太难的东西,80%的基础指的就是JAVA中的JAVASE。所以JAVASE是很重要的部分,如果学不好JAVASE,那JAVA基本就是白学,后面的框架肯定也会听不懂。掌握核心,精力就多集中在核心的部分。关于数据库,就增删
转载
2023-10-17 10:42:25
74阅读
数据库学习及总结 Mysql数据库调优篇 二、软件测试 1、功能测试 功能测试_通用方法 功能测试_报表
转载
2022-04-13 10:25:33
191阅读
什么是dockerfile?Dockerfile是一个包含用于组合映像的命令的文本文档。可以使用在命令行中调用任何命令。 Docker通过读取Dockerfile中的指令自动生成映像。docker build命令用于从Dockerfile构建映像。可以在docker build命令中使用-f标志指向文件系统中任何位置的Dockerfile。例:docker build -f /path/to/a/
一、微服务以及分布式数据管理中存在的问题单体应用通常使用单个关系型数据库,由此带来的好处在于应用能够使用 ACID 事务,后者提供了重要的操作特性:原子化:原子粒度的更改一致性:数据库的状态始终保持一致隔离:并发执行的事务显示为串行执行持久:事务一旦提交就不会被撤销如此,应用能够简单地开始事务、更改(插入、更新和删除)多行、以及提交事务。使用关系型数据库的另一大好处是它支持 SQL。SQL 是一门
转载
2024-03-25 13:59:59
30阅读
本节主要介绍数据库涉及到的技术,包括数据库系统、SQL 语言和数据库访问技术。 数据库系统 数据库管理系统(Database Management System,DBMS)是位于操作系统与用户之间的一种操纵和管理数据库的软件,按照一定的数据模型科学地组织和存储数据,同时可以提供数据高效地获取和维护。
原创
2019-10-21 14:28:00
901阅读
数据库同步过程,最严格的指标:第一是效率,即每秒同步SQL条数;第二是一致性,即主库产生的数据,备库同步后是否一致;第三是完整性,即当同步的各个环节出现问题时,如何考虑出错处理;下面分别讨论并进行测试方案合理性分析,如下:第一、效率同步测试的两个表都增加:精确到毫秒的创建时间和修改时间字段,用于对比数据同步的整体效率。具体效率测试:数据库同步过程主要分为四个阶段,即抽取、分析、传输、装载。抽取过程
转载
2024-08-01 20:21:10
67阅读
从测试过程的角度来说我们也可以把数据库测试分为 系统测试 传统软件系统测试的测试重点是需求覆盖,而对于我们的数据库测试同样也需要对需求覆盖进行保证。
转载
2018-05-04 17:24:00
141阅读
软件应用程序已经离不开数据库。无论是在Web、桌面应用、客户端服务器、企业和个人业务,都需要数据库在后端操作。同样的在金融、租赁、零售、邮寄、医疗领域中,数据库也是不可缺少的。 随着应用的复杂程度增加需要更强大和安全系数高的数据库才可以满足需求。为了满足高频率的应用程序事务(如银行或财务应用),数据 ...
转载
2021-10-12 22:27:00
159阅读
2评论
什么是myisam引擎
myisam引擎是MySQL关系数据库系统的默认储存引擎(mysql 5.5.5之前)。这种MySQL表存储结构从旧的ISAM代码扩展出许多有用的功能。在新版本的Mysql中,Innodb引擎由于其对事务参照完整性,以及更高的并发性等优点开始逐步取代Myisam引擎。
每一个myisam的表都对应于硬盘上的三个文件。这三个文件有一
转载
2023-09-10 16:54:30
44阅读
数据库测试:之前写的数据库测试代码稍微有点繁杂,现在我们将这些代码进行简化一下,将备份、还原数据的方法单独写在一个类里,然后测试类继承于这个类。代码示例:测试类代码示例:测试类的代码稍微更改了一下,让测试的覆盖率提高测试结果:测量测试覆盖率:测量测试覆盖率就是测量测试代码运行了多少个测试分支,如果测试代码的全部分支都被运行了,那么测试覆盖率就是100%。打个比方就是一个猎人挖了100个不同的陷阱,
原创
2017-10-27 13:35:39
1181阅读
在软件使用过程中出现单据锁定提示,进入系统管理清除单据锁定,再进入软件还是提示单据锁定.(包括:审核凭证时提示单据锁定;不能录入期初余额,提示单据锁定;银行对帐单锁定 等情况)
造成单据锁定或者异常的可能原因是非法退出或非法关机造成的
如果在系统管理的清除异常任务和清除单据锁定仍然不能解决问题,可以考虑清除数据库里的以下几张表
Ua_task(功能操作控制表)、Ua_tasklo
转载
2008-07-28 08:21:00
162阅读
2评论
对于数据库部分,一般需要进行功能测试,容错测试,性能测试,安全测试等,这个也要根据产品特性和需求决定,具体决定需要测试哪些方面,简单说明如下,大家可以继续补充。1.性能并发测试:例如之前updater讨论会,有提到的数据库的并发测试,结合响应时间的测试:1)与数据库连接的服务程序采用多线程同时开启多个数据库连接;2)与数据库连接的服务程序单线程,但是同时开启多套服务程序;以上两种情况均会产生对数据
转载
2024-08-03 13:11:16
46阅读
软件测试的
14
种基本方
法
软件测试是指使用人工或者自动的手段来运行或测定某个软件产品系统的过程,其目的是在于检验是否满足规定的需求或者弄清预期的结果与实际结果的区别。本文主要描述软件测试的方法。
1
数据和数据库完整性测试
数据与数据库完整测试是指测试关系型数据库完整性原则以及数据合理性测试。
数据库完整性
Oracle Database,又名Oracle RDBMS,或简称Oracle。是甲骨文公司的一款关系数据库管理系统。它是在数据库领域一直处于领先地位的产品。可以说Oracle数据库系统是目前世界上流行的关系数据库管理系统,系统可移植性好、使用方便、功能强,适用于各类大、中、小、微机环境。它是一种高效率、可靠性好的 适应高吞吐量的数据库解决方案。针对Oracle数据库如何测试呢?检测数据库端口是
转载
2024-05-28 22:44:33
51阅读
对于今天测试方面的提高一直很模糊,但最近整理好了思路。今年重点还是在数据库的测试方向上下手吧,因为我们公司的数据库中数据准确性非常重要,希望能提高自己对这一方面的工作经验吧。 前期一直进行数据库的测试,大约3个月。也总结了一些测试经验,拿出来与大家共享。1、数据库日志查看测试法。这个方法是跟一个oracel DB
转载
2023-07-29 13:23:01
61阅读
1: 关系模式中,满足2NF的模式,______。
A. 可能是1NF C. 必定是1NF
B. 必定是3NF D. 必定是BCNF
解答: C
2: 设有如图所示的关系R,
它是____。
A. 1NF
B. 2NF
C. 3NF
D. BCNF
原创
2011-01-04 12:10:50
3046阅读
点赞
数据库安全最佳实践 其中一些方法包括: 您需要限制未经授权的访问,使用非常强大的凭据,并实施多因素访问。 对数据库进行负载/压力测试
原创
2022-08-05 14:22:30
365阅读